    Apply the Eight AgilePM Principles

    Use the eight principles, from focus on the business need to demonstrate control, to guide real project decisions and keep quality and timelines protected throughout delivery.

    Run the AgilePM Lifecycle End to End

    Move a project through Pre-Project, Feasibility, Foundations, Exploration, Engineering and Deployment, producing the right management products and decisions at each phase.

    Prioritise Scope with MoSCoW

    Apply Must, Should, Could and Won't have prioritisation to fix time and cost while flexing scope, so you can commit to on-time delivery even under pressure.

    Deliver Iteratively with Timeboxing

    Plan and control timeboxes through Kick-Off, Investigation, Refinement and Closing, managing iterations and increments across a project without slipping deadlines.

    Assign AgilePM Roles and Govern Teams

    Structure business, technical and management roles, from Business Sponsor to Project Manager, and manage team dynamics so business and delivery work together.

    Plan, Control and Manage Risk

    Plan at strategic, tactical and operational levels, track progress with burndown and timebox data, and manage risk within the AgilePM governance model.

    How is AgilePM different from Scrum?

    Scrum is a team-level delivery framework focused on sprints and three core roles. AgilePM is a project-level governance framework covering the full lifecycle, from strategic alignment to benefits realisation, with defined business, technical and management roles. AgilePM provides the governance wrapper around agile delivery.

    What is the format of the AgilePM Foundation exam?

    The Foundation exam is a closed-book, multiple-choice paper of 50 single-answer questions completed in 40 minutes. You need 50%, or 25 correct answers, to pass. It is usually taken at the end of the Foundation portion of the course.

    What is the format of the AgilePM Practitioner exam?

    The Practitioner exam is open book, allowing the AgilePM Handbook. It has 4 scenario-based questions worth 15 marks each, 60 marks in total, over 2 hours. You need 50%, or 30 marks, to pass. Questions require analysis and judgement, not simple look-up.
